Copy of postcard of the Gottlieb Martin-Cookingham House. Caption in 'A Brief History of Red Hook' reads: Built in the summer of 1776 by Gottlieb (sometimes spelled Gottlop) Martin for his newly married son, the stuccoed stone house remained in the Martin famly until Oakleigh Cookingham bought the farm in 1933. The cornerstone was laid July 4 1776. It is said that a small contingent of Continental soliders passed by the Old Post Road as the frame was raised that summer, dropped their gear and lent a hand.Subject Place
